COUNCIL TAX BANDING Band C. ABOUT OUGHTIBRIDGE Oughtibridge is a highly sought after village situated in the North of Sheffield approximately 6 miles from Sheffield City Centre. The village has access to a variety of amenities including shops, schools, pubs, restaurants, Coronation Park and public transport links to Sheffield via bus. The property in Oughtibridge varies from stone built character properties to more modern developments of houses and apartments which attract a cross section of buyers.
